General Usage Ideas

  • Sauté chopped leeks, mushrooms, diced onions, and garlic; add chopped potatoes, thyme, and vegetable stock; simmer until tender, purée and add touch of cream.
  • Add chopped leeks and smoked salmon while scrambling eggs and cream; serve with snipped chives.

Fall / Winter Usage Ideas:

  • Toss together thinly sliced leeks, chopped Granny Smith apples, shredded carrots, and crumbled bacon; stir in mayonnaise, salt, and pepper.
  • Arrange halved leeks in a baking dish; top with butter, salt, garlic, and Parmesan cheese; roast until tender.
  • Add sauteed leek tops and bases with fettucine, pine nuts, shredded kale, and roasted mushrooms.

Spring / Summer Usage Ideas:

  • Steam halved leeks until tender; dress with grainy mustard vinaigrette then top with chopped egg and chervil.
  • Top flatbreads and pizza with leek rounds, black pepper, and blue cheese; bake until crust is crunchy and cheese is bubbly.
  • Mix chopped leeks, fresh peas, and mint into your favorite risotto recipe.
